Question Oblivion IV - Sound Stuttering

Hi All-

I just purchased the new Oblivion on PC/DVD and it's going great though I do have a music stuttering issue. When I open the game on my desktop the music stutters and when I encounter an enemy, the music that lets me know when an emeny is close suddenly stutters out. It drops below where it is barely audible.

I checked my speakers, etc and I have not encountered this problem with any of my other games.

Re: Oblivion IV - Sound Stuttering

Without knowing anything about your system, it's tough to solve this. My suggestions would be to do the following, in this order, and try not to go onto the next step before you do the one before it and see if that works:

Close any background programs you're running. Update your audio drivers. Check to see if your hard drive lights up when music stutters; if it does, defragment. Go to the Oblivion forums where they know what they're talking about. Reinstall the game. Buy a sound card.

Re: Oblivion IV - Sound Stuttering

There is a switch in the INI which varies. It's either bAllowSoftwareAudio=0/1 or bAllowHardwareAudio=0/1. may wanna try disabling hardware and enabling software, or vice versa.
